Our Huskies

Our 35+ sled dogs are the heart and soul of our operation, cherished members of our family.
Some of these sweet hearts were born here, while others have been rescued
from difficult circumstances.
Each one carries a unique story, and at our kennel, you'll meet mainly Alaskan Huskies from a variety of working-bred lines, along with a few Siberian Huskies and Scandinavian Hounds.

Our dogs come in many different sizes, shapes, and colors
– something that often surprises our guests.
But to us, what truly matters isn't how they look, but who they are.
Every dog in our team shares a deep love for running, for people, and for each other.
They work as a family, and we choose each one not for their appearance, but for their heart, spirit, and their joy in doing what they love.


Pajala Huskies

Nestled in the picturesque town of Pajala in Swedish Lapland, near the Finnish border, we offer unforgettable dog sledding adventures. Our small, family-run kennel specializes in Huskies, with tours for everyone.
Whether you're after a thrilling short adventure or a longer exploration of the Torne Valley, we are committed to providing an exceptional, personalized experience.

We cooperate with local businesses to offer authentic experiences with local food and Husky adventures.

Melina –
Originally from Finland, I was raised in the Torne Valley, where sled dogs have been part of my life since childhood. We had them at home when I was growing up, so you could say I've been working with sled dogs since 1996.

In 2010, I began working full-time as a professional guide in Finland, running tours for large kennels. While I enjoyed that work, I always dreamed of having my own team and returning to my roots in Swedish Lapland.

In 2019, we settled in the small village of Kieksiäisvaara, where my husband is from, in the heart of the Torne Valley. Since then, both our daughter and a few new generations of husky puppies have been born here.

Alongside our working dogs, we've also welcomed several rescued dogs who have found a forever home with us.

Together as a family — humans and huskies — we now offer magical adventures here in the peaceful wilderness of Lapland.
